WebMorover, after destruction of β-cells by streptozotocin, β-cells regenerated from cells that had previously expressed glucagon. Thorel et al. (2010) produced near total ablation of β-cells in the mouse pancreas by conditional expression of diphtheria toxin. While the mice were kept alive by insulin injections, β-cells regenerated (Fig. 5.16). WebHow is insulin released from beta cells? WebInsulin and C-peptide are stored in secretory vesicles which upon stimulation by glucose and other secretagogues, are released at equimolar concentration [58]. Following secretion, insulin and the C-peptide pass through the liver. In contrast to insulin, the C-peptide has a longer half-life (30–35 min) [57]. how to use magic bullet miniWebHow insulin works.
